Output 523a3173136af165e714567b901c3d43523babb17b17f49b617e96a3e7c00d03:183

value
975569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d2bdbc649a68a1832fb9d0f65ecd9e8833790c OP_EQUAL
address
3EoV1XZVYgWctzVgdgVX2FC9y7c4D7wDXF
transaction
523a3173136af165e714567b901c3d43523babb17b17f49b617e96a3e7c00d03
confirmations
177414
spent
true